So it's pretty obvious none of you have ever used or properly researched adapters, so why are you all voicing opinions on them? :S
Any decent adapter will be made to be properly hubcentric to your car and to the bolt pattern you are adapting to. And they will be provided with the proper strength bolts. I've been running adapters on my E30 for two years, and on a VW Golf for three years prior to that. My Golf ones were custom 12mm thick 4x100 to 5x112 (Audi), and came with studs inserted as they were too narrow to allow a proper grip of a bolt.Joe Funk -- Portland Oregon
